About the Role
We are seeking a highly experienced and skilled Financial Manager to join our team in Durban.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ing and managing the full finance function, including accounting, budgeting, forecasting, and reporting. They will provide strategic financial analysis and insights to support executive decision-making, while ensuring compliance with all statutory, regulatory, and tax requirements.
Key Responsibilities
- Oversee and manage the full finance function
- Prepare and review monthly management accounts and annual financial statements
- Manage cash flow, working capital, and financial risk
- Develop and implement financial policies, procedures, and internal controls
- Provide strategic financial analysis and insights to support executive decision-making
- Lead, mentor, and manage the finance team
- Liaise with external auditors, bankers, and other financial stakeholders
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in finance, Accounting, or a related field (essential)
- Professional qualification such as CA(SA), CIMA, or ACCA (preferred)
- 810 years proven experience in a financial management role
- Strong knowledge of South African financial regulations and tax legislation
- Advanced proficiency in accounting software and Microsoft Excel
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in finance, Accounting, or a related field
- Professional qualification such as CA(SA), CIMA, or ACCA

About Accounting / Finance Jobs in eThekwini
The accounting and finance industry is a vital component of eThekwini’s economy, providing essential services to businesses, governments, and individuals. Generally, job seekers in this field can expect a stable and secure career with opportunities for growth and development. Typically, roles in accounting and finance are found across various industries, including financ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and public sector.
Salaries for accounting and finance professionals in eThekwini vary widely dep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. Common salary ranges for entry-level positions typically start between R200 000 to R300 000 per annum, while senior roles can range from R500 000 to R800 000 or more. However, these figures are general estimates and actual salaries may vary significantly. It is essential to research the specific job market and industry trends to determine realistic salary expectations.
Common skills required for accounting and finance roles in eThekwini include proficiency in financial software, such as SAP or Oracle; strong analytical and problem-solving skills; excellent communication and interpersonal skills; experience with budgeting, forecasting, and financial analysis tools; a solid understanding of tax laws and regulations; and a degree in accounting or finance. Additionally, many employers require candidates to hold relevant professional certifications, such as the Chartered Accountant (SA) designation.
Accounting and finance professionals can be found across various industries, including financ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and public sector. The financial services sector is often a major employer of accounting and finance professionals in eThekwini, while the technology industry also provides many opportunities for growth and development. Other industries, such as manufacturing and construction, also require skilled accounting and finance professionals to manage their finances effectively.
Career development opportunities are abundant in the accounting and finance field, with many employers offering training and development programs to help employees advance in their careers. Typically, experienced accountants can move into senior roles or take on leadership positions within their companies. With experience and additional certifications, accountants can transition into management roles, such as financial controller or accountant manager, or pursue career paths in finance consulting or public practice.
